## Deploying the Gatewick Proctor Queue

Deploys are pretty painless: push to main, wait for the pipeline, then watch the queue drain dashboard for five minutes. If candidates pile up mid-exam, roll back first and ask questions later — the queue replays safely. Everything the workers care about lives in one config block, shown here for reference.

settings of bafof-yagef:
JOROX_PIN=8740
JOROX_TENANT=pelox
JOROX_METRICS_HOST=metrics.jorox.qorvelworks.internal
JOROX_SEAL=seal_c78f63c1
JOROX_STANDBY_TEAM=norax

**Runbook: Account Recovery — Export Retries**

When Fernvale exports fail three times, the retry worker suspends the service account automatically. Annoying, but it stops runaway loops. To get exports moving again, check the dead-letter queue first, clear anything stale, then re-enable the account via the Ketterby console. When prompted during re-enablement, supply the recovery passphrase listed just below this line:

unlock words, hahip-baduf: holwyn-istath-julvan

Hey — handing off the Brindlewood SFTP drop before I'm out. Their partner, Quollix, pushes feed files nightly around 02:00, and our Ferrostat poller picks them up within ten minutes. Plugin authors should never hardcode the drop path; read it from the service config. If files stall, check the poller logs first. The current connection settings for the drop are as follows.

deployment values, bahof-fafop:
[praix]
team = gilox
access_code = ac_912228
owner = norael.drudor
host = praix.merlaqnet.example
port = 9200
peer = casox.braskforge.example
salt = 18456988
pin = 5596

## Configuration — FareForge rules engine

Support: all shipping-fee rules load from `rules.yaml`; never edit in prod, use the Caldmere admin panel. The engine reads `.env` at boot. `FF_REGION` sets the default zone table, `FF_CURRENCY` the rounding mode. Restart after any change. The rate-provider API requires an access key for live quotes. Append that key on the line below.

env line for fafof-fahag: LEDGER_TOKEN5=f8790